Image of a bouquet of flowers with multiple different types of flowers making up the bouquet. On the right, on the top of a stem there is a grasshopper, and in the middle of the bouquet, on top of some leaves there is a snail. The bouquet is held together with an orange ribbon.

Brief description
Engraving, "Bouquet of Flowers", by Nicholas Robert, pub. 1683 in Paris, ink and paper
